
Kalyan Sunkavalli
I am a Senior Principal Scientist at Adobe Research, where I lead a team advancing generative AI for image, video, and 3D creation and editing. We develop ambitious research ideas from conception through publication, scale them into production-ready technologies, and help bring them into Adobe products used by millions of creators, including Photoshop, Substance 3D, and Firefly.
My work focuses on making visual content creation more intuitive, expressive, and controllable by combining the creative power of generative models with the structure and precision of spatial intelligence. One example is our recently released Rotate Object feature in Photoshop, which lifts single photos into 3D so creators can intuitively experiment with composition and perspective.
I received my Ph.D. from Harvard University, where I was advised by Hanspeter Pfister, and my M.S. from Columbia University, where I was advised by Ravi Ramamoorthi. I completed my undergraduate degree at the Indian Institute of Technology, Delhi.
